#f01560 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#f01560 is composed of 94.1% red, 8.2% green and 37.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 91.3% magenta, 60% yellow and 5.9% black. It has a hue angle of 339.5 degrees, a saturation of 88% and a lightness of 51.2%. #f01560 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ff2ac0 with #e10000. Closest websafe color is: #ff0066.

#f01560 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#f01560 has RGB values of R:240, G:21, B:96 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.91, Y:0.6, K:0.06. Its decimal value is 15734112.

Shades and Tints of #f01560
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#060002 is the darkest color, while #fef2f6 is the lightest one.
